Nearly Unique Bank of Nebraska $5 Proof

Omaha City, NE- Bank of Nebraska $5 18__ G10a Walton 3 Proof PCGS Banknote Choice Unc 64 Details.
Bank of Nebraska notes are excessively rare in Proof form. Produced by Toppan, Carpenter & Co., this example's design was only listed in the Haxby reference as a remainder, and an image of a plate note was not provided. The design of this incredible piece is quite charming, with a portrait of Mrs. B.F. Allen, wife of the first president of this institution, at right and a large red-orange "5" overprint at center which adds both color and aesthetic appeal. At left is a complex vignette of a large side profile bust of President George Washington surrounded by various allegorical figures. A soldier of the Continental Army analyzes the former general's portrait at immediate left, and Liberty clutches her pole and cap at immediate right. In the foreground, two Native Americans, one holding a spear and the other seated on a rock formation, also focus on Washington's depiction. This ornate piece is printed on India paper mounted to cardstock, and no forms of cancellation are present. We are aware of one other representative of this design in Proof form, and we offered that note in May 2024. Certified at the PCGS Banknote Choice Unc 64 level, it brought $2,880. On this piece, PCGS Banknote comments on stains which are most apparent at left on the face.
